Donald van der Vaart has been secretary of the N.C. Department of Environment and Natural Resources since Jan. 1, 2015. Van der Vaart had served as DENR's deputy secretary and as the department’s energy policy adviser since August 2014. Prior to that, he worked as an engineering supervisor and later as program manager for the N.C. Division of Air Quality. He also teaches environmental policy and law at N.C. State University. His previous work includes scientific research at Virginia Polytechnic Institute and State University and at Research Triangle Institute. Van der Vaart also has experience in research and regulatory positions for energy and utility companies in the private sector. In this speech, he discusses “EPA Intrusion: The Federal Power Grab Over North Carolina’s Environment."
